顶:=85; 中:=50; 底:=20; VAR1:=HHV(HIGH,9)-LLV(LOW,9); VAR2:=HHV(HIGH,9)-CLOSE; VAR3:=CLOSE-LLV(LOW,9); VAR4:=VAR2/VAR1*100-70; VAR5:=(CLOSE-LLV(LOW,60))/(HHV(HIGH,60)-LLV(LOW,60))*100; VAR6:=(2*CLOSE+HIGH+LOW)/4; VAR7:=SMA(VAR3/VAR1*100,3,1); VAR8:=LLV(LOW,34); VAR9:=SMA(VAR7,3,1)-SMA(VAR4,9,1); VARA:=IF(VAR9>100,VAR9-100,0); VARB:=HHV(HIGH,34); AAW:= VARA*2; BB:= EMA((VAR6-VAR8)/(VARB-VAR8)*100,13); VARC:=EMA(0.667*REF(BB,1)+0.333*BB,2); CC:SMA(VAR5,20,1),COLORRED; CC1:SMA(CC,5,1),COLORGREEN; STICKLINE(CC>CC1,CC,CC1,1,0),COLORRED; STICKLINE(CC1>CC,CC,CC1,1,0),COLORGREEN; 出击:=IF((CROSS(CC,CC1) AND (CC1 < 顶) ),80,0); STICKLINE(出击,100,CC1,2,0.5),COLORRED; {跑} DRAWICON(CC < REF(CC,1) AND REF(CC,1) < REF(CC,2) AND CC > CC1,100,2); DRAWICON(CROSS(CC1,CC),100,15); RSV:=(((CLOSE - LLV(LOW,9)) / (HHV(HIGH,9) - LLV(LOW,9))) * 100); 短期底部:=LLV(OPEN,30);K:=SMA(RSV,3,1),COLORFFFFFF;D:=SMA(K,3,1),COLOR00FFFF; J:=3*K-2*D;AA10:=MA(CLOSE,10); AA1:=MA(CLOSE,12);BB10:=((ATAN((AA10 - REF(AA10,1))) * 3.1416) * 10); BB1:=((ATAN((AA1 - REF(AA1,1))) * 3.1416) * 10); MA13:=MA(CLOSE,13);VAR2Q:=(((CLOSE - MA(CLOSE,6)) / MA(CLOSE,6)) * 100); VAR3Q:=(((CLOSE - MA(CLOSE,12)) / MA(CLOSE,12)) * 100); VAR4Q:=(((CLOSE - MA(CLOSE,24)) / MA(CLOSE,24)) * 100); VAR5Q:=(((VAR2Q + (2 * VAR3Q)) + (3 * VAR4Q)) / 6); VAR6Q:=MA(VAR5Q,3);GG1:=IF(VAR6Q ,20,0); DRAWICON(CROSS(J,K) AND (GG1 >= 20) AND CC>CC1,40,13); DRAWTEXT(CROSS(J,K) AND (GG1 >= 20) AND CC>CC1,55,'启'); DRAWTEXT(CROSS(J,K) AND (GG1 >= 20) AND CC>CC1,44,'爆'); {★底部提示:通用} VAR2T:=(CLOSE-LLV(LOW,20))/(HHV(HIGH,20)-LLV(LOW,20))*100; VAR3T:=SMA(SMA(VAR2T,3,1),3,1)/28.57; VAR4T:=EMA(VAR3T,5); VAR5T:=3*VAR3T-2*VAR4T; AAT:=CROSS(VAR5T,VAR3T) AND VAR3T<2.1 AND C>O; STICKLINE(AAT AND CC>CC1,0,20,20,1),COLORYELLOW; STICKLINE(AAT AND CC>CC1,4,10,19,0),COLORRED; STICKLINE(AAT AND CC>CC1,1,4,19,0),COLORRED; STICKLINE(AAT AND CC>CC1,5,5,20,1),COLORYELLOW; STICKLINE(AAT AND CC>CC1,10,20,5,0),COLORYELLOW; STICKLINE(AAT AND CC>CC1,100,102,5,1),COLORRED; STICKLINE(AAT AND CC>CC1,104,106,5,1),COLORRED; STICKLINE(AAT AND CC>CC1,108,110,5,1),COLORRED; STICKLINE(AAT AND CC>CC1,112,114,5,1),COLORRED; STICKLINE(AAT AND CC>CC1,116,118,6,0),COLORFFCCCC; DRAWTEXT(AAT AND CC>CC1,120,'底'),COLORYELLOW; TYP:=(HIGH+LOW+CLOSE)/3; CCI:(TYP-MA(TYP,84))/(0.015*AVEDEV(TYP,84))>100 COLORBLACK; AA:COUNT(CCI=1,2)<=1 AND COUNT(CCI=1,2)>0 AND NOT(BARSLAST(CCI=1)>=1 AND BARSLAST(CCI=1)<2) AND C/REF(C,1)>1.095 AND C>MA(C,60); IF(COUNT(BARSLAST(AA=1)>=1 ,2)>1 AND CCI=1 AND C>MA(C,14),CCI,DRAWNULL)COLOR0000F3; STICKLINE(AA AND CC>CC1,0,8,1,1) COLOR00FFF3; STICKLINE(AA AND CC>CC1,8,16,4,0)COLOR00D6F3; STICKLINE(AA AND CC>CC1,16,24,6,1) COLOR00B2F3; STICKLINE(AA AND CC>CC1,24,36,8,0) COLOR0085F3; STICKLINE(AA AND CC>CC1,36,40,10,1) COLOR0018F3; LS:=C/REF(C,1)>1.048 AND C=H AND BETWEEN(FORCAST(V,4),0.2*FORCAST(V,12),2.1*FORCAST(V,12)); XG: FILTER(LS,28); A:=CROSS(SMA(CLOSE,2,1),SMA(LOW,5,1)); A1:=(SMA(HIGH,21,2)*1.05)*1.05; A2:=IF(A,A1,SMA(LOW,5,1)); A3:=CROSS(SMA(CLOSE,2,1),(SMA(HIGH,21,2)*1.05)); A4:=IF(A3,(SMA(HIGH,21,2)*1.05)*1.10,(SMA(LOW,21,2)*0.95)); A5:=A2>SMA(LOW,5,1) AND CROSS(C,REF(MA(C,13),13/2+1)) AND VOL>0; A6:=REF(H/O<1.02,1) AND REF(C(SMA(LOW,21,2)*0.95) OR A5 AND A6; DRAWTEXT(在主升抓牛 AND CC>CC1,22,'<--在主升抓牛'),COLORRED; STICKLINE(在主升抓牛 AND CC>CC1,40,25,1,0),COLORYELLOW; STICKLINE(在主升抓牛 AND CC>CC1,25,10,2,0),COLOR00FF00; STICKLINE(在主升抓牛 AND CC>CC1,10,0,2,0),COLORBLUE; STICKLINE(在主升抓牛 AND CC>CC1,25,15,0.5,0),COLORRED; STICKLINE(在主升抓牛 AND CC>CC1,15,6,1,0),COLOR00FF00; STICKLINE(在主升抓牛 AND CC>CC1,6,0,2,0),COLORBLUE; {绝对主升源码} 清仓:=1.66*MA(FORCAST(CLOSE,2),40),COLORRED; 出货:=1.36*MA(FORCAST(CLOSE,2),40),COLOR08FFFF; 高抛:=1.16*MA(FORCAST(CLOSE,2),40),COLORFF82FF; 低吸:=0.82*MA(FORCAST(CLOSE,2),40),COLORF7E300; 满仓:=0.72*MA(FORCAST(CLOSE,2),40),COLORGREEN; 强通1:=清仓>REF(清仓,1); 强通2:=出货>REF(出货,1); 强通3:=高抛>REF(高抛,1); 强通4:=低吸>REF(低吸,1); 强通5:=满仓>REF(满仓,1); 上升通道:=强通1 AND 强通2 AND 强通3 AND 强通4 AND 强通5; MA5:=MA(CLOSE,5); MA10:=MA(CLOSE,10); MA20:=MA(CLOSE,20); MA30:=MA(CLOSE,30); MA60:=MA(CLOSE,60); 五强:=MA5>REF(MA5,1); 十强:=MA10>REF(MA10,1); 二十强:=MA20>REF(MA20,1); 三十强:=MA30>REF(MA30,1); 六十强:=MA60>REF(MA60,1); 小均强:=五强 AND 十强; 均强:=十强 AND 二十强 AND 三十强; 大均强:=十强 AND 二十强 AND 三十强 AND 六十强; JJD:=(H+L+C)/3; 强势线1:=HHV(MA((((LOW + HIGH) + CLOSE) / 3),8),60),COLORRED,LINETHICK2; 强势线2:=HHV(MA((((LOW + HIGH) + CLOSE) / 3.18),8),20),COLORWHITE,LINETHICK2; 强势线3:=HHV(MA((((LOW + HIGH) + CLOSE) / 3.258),8),10),COLORYELLOW,LINETHICK2; 强势线4:=HHV(MA((((LOW + HIGH) + CLOSE) / 3.08),80),13),COLORLIMAGENTA,LINETHICK2; 开始走强1:=强势线1>REF(强势线1,1); 开始走强2:=强势线2>REF(强势线2,1); 开始走强3:=强势线3>REF(强势线3,1); 开始走强4:=强势线4>REF(强势线3,1); 双强1:=开始走强1 AND 开始走强2; 双强2:=开始走强2 AND 开始走强3; 双强3:=开始走强2 AND 开始走强3; 双强4:=开始走强3 AND 开始走强4; 三强:=开始走强1 AND 开始走强2 AND 开始走强3; 四强:=开始走强1 AND 开始走强2 AND 开始走强3 AND 开始走强4; 强势为王:=双强1 OR 双强2 OR 双强3 OR 双强4 OR 三强 OR 四强; VV:=(C+L+H)/3; DSA:=SMA(MA(VV,15),2,1)LINETHICK3; 顶部1:=DSA*1.0888,COLORMAGENTA,LINETHICK1; 顶部2:=DSA*1.158,COLORBROWN,LINETHICK1; 顶部3:=DSA*1.218,COLORRED,LINETHICK1; 底部1:=DSA*0.9518,COLORLICYAN,LINETHICK1; 底部2:=DSA*0.888,COLORLIMAGENTA,LINETHICK1; 底部3:=DSA*0.8,COLORGREEN,LINETHICK1; MA1:=MA(CLOSE,5); MA2:=MA(CLOSE,10); MA3:=MA(CLOSE,20); MA4:=MA(CLOSE,60); 五日走强:=MA1>REF(MA1,1); 十日走强:=MA2>REF(MA2,1); 二十日走强:=MA3>REF(MA3,1); 六十日走强:=MA4>REF(MA4,1); 低位主升:=五日走强 AND 十日走强 AND 六十日走强; 主升浪:=五日走强 AND 十日走强 AND 二十日走强; 大主升浪:=十日走强 AND 二十日走强 AND 六十日走强; 大主升浪2:=五日走强 AND 十日走强 AND 二十日走强 AND 六十日走强; 总主升:=主升浪 AND 大主升浪 AND 大主升浪2; 总主升浪:=低位主升 OR 主升浪 OR 大主升浪 OR 大主升浪2 OR 总主升; 强势主升低买:L<底部1 AND 总主升浪 AND 强势为王 AND C0 AND CC>CC1,11,1); STICKLINE(猎股小王>0 AND CC>CC1,40,0,1,0),COLORYELLOW; DRAWTEXT(猎股小王>0 AND CC>CC1,100,'猎'); DRAWTEXT(猎股小王>0 AND CC>CC1,90,'股'); DRAWTEXT(猎股小王>0 AND CC>CC1,80,'小'); DRAWTEXT(猎股小王>0 AND CC>CC1,70,'王'); 猎股大王出击:=强势主升低买 AND 猎股小王 AND HA2J OR REF(HIGH,1)>REF(A2J,1),A1J,A4J),LINETHICK3,COLORRED; 生命线:=IF(HIGH*1.01>A2J OR REF(HIGH,1)>REF(A2J,1),A2J,A4J),LINETHICK3,COLORFFFFFF; 主升持仓:=持仓>生命线; 主升1:=持仓>REF(持仓,1); 主升2:=生命线>REF(生命线,1); 主升:=主升1 AND 主升2; 主升猎股王:=(猎股大王出击 AND 主升持仓 AND 主升) OR (猎股小王 AND 主升持仓 AND 主升); 绝对的主升:(主升猎股王 AND 小均强) OR (猎股小王 AND 小均强),COLORYELLOW,LINETHICK4,STICK; STICKLINE(绝对的主升>0 AND CC>CC1,100,0,1,1),COLORYELLOW; DRAWTEXT(绝对的主升 AND CC>CC1,140,'绝'); DRAWTEXT(绝对的主升 AND CC>CC1,130,'对'); DRAWTEXT(绝对的主升 AND CC>CC1,120,'主'); DRAWTEXT(绝对的主升 AND CC>CC1,110,'升'); 卧龙区:15,COLORGREEN; 蓄势区:20,COLORGREEN; 卧龙出山:40,COLORRED; A1S:=SUM(VOL,43)/CAPITAL; AS:=LLV(DMA(CLOSE,VOL/CAPITAL),120); 龙抬头:200*(CLOSE-AS)/AS,COLORRED,LINETHICK2; DRAWICON(卧龙出山>40 AND REF(卧龙出山,1)<40 AND CC>CC1,40,13); ST:=EXIST((C/REF(C,1)-1)*100>5.6,60); 停牌:=DYNAINFO(4)>0; 高价:=DYNAINFO(7)<40; 大盘股:=CAPITAL/1000000<=50; 基础选股:=ST AND 停牌 AND 高价 AND 大盘股; DIF:=EMA(CLOSE,12)-EMA(CLOSE,26); DEA:=EMA(DIF,9); JC1:=CROSS(DIF,DEA) AND DEA>0; AA2:=COUNT(CROSS(DIF,DEA),20)=1; LXJC1:=EVERY(DIF>0,5); FL:=V>MA(V,5)*1.5; QG:=HHV(H,10); TPQG:=H>REF(QG,2); HS:=VOL*100/CAPITAL<10; YYLM:=JC1 AND FL AND TPQG AND LXJC1 AND HS; ZSXG:基础选股 AND YYLM; DRAWTEXT(ZSXG AND CC>CC1,80,'捕'); DRAWTEXT(ZSXG AND CC>CC1,70,'捉'); DRAWTEXT(ZSXG AND CC>CC1,60,'主'); DRAWTEXT(ZSXG AND CC>CC1,50,'升'); {苍狼主升} 较量:EMA((CLOSE-MA((2*CLOSE+HIGH+LOW)/4,30))/MA((2*CLOSE+HIGH+LOW)/4,30)*100,3),COLORWHITE; STICKLINE(较量<-10,0,较量,0,0),COLORGREEN; STICKLINE(较量>10,0,较量,0,0),COLORYELLOW; 买点1:IF(CROSS(较量,0) AND CC>CC1,20,0),COLORYELLOW,LINETHICK3; A4Z:=(2*C+H+L)/4; A5Z:=LLV(L,94); A6Z:=HHV(H,89); 快信号:=EMA((C-A5Z)/(A6-A5Z)*100,8); 慢信号:=EMA(0.667*REF(快信号,1)+0.333*快信号,10); AAZ:=COUNT(买点1>=40,5)>0; 买点2:IF(CROSS(快信号,慢信号) AND AAZ AND CC>CC1,20,0),COLORRED,LINETHICK3; PA1:=EVERY(C>O,3) AND C>REF(C,1) AND REF(C,1)>REF(C,2); PA2:=V/REF(V,1)>1.85; PA3:=REF(V,1)/REF(V,2)>1.85; PA4:=REF(V,1)MA(C,5) AND C>MA(C,10) AND C>MA(C,20) AND C>MA(C,30); XG8:=PA1 AND PA2 AND PA3 AND PA4 AND JX; DRAWTEXT(XG8 AND CC>CC1,80,'主升先兆'); {主升浪快了} HDY:=EMA (100*(C-LLV(LOW,34))/(HHV(H,34)-LLV(LOW,34)),3); 主升浪K:COUNT(HDY<10,2) AND CROSS(CCI(84),-100) AND HHV(H,14)/LLV(L,6)>1.21 AND COUNT(C/REF(C,1)<0.95,6),COLORRED; 多空:EMA((CLOSE-MA((2*CLOSE+HIGH+LOW)/4,30))/MA((2*CLOSE+HIGH+LOW)/4,30)*100,3),COLORWHITE; 0,COLORRED; STICKLINE(多空<-10,0,多空,0,0),COLORGREEN; STICKLINE(多空>10,0,多空,0,0),COLORYELLOW; RSVK:=(((CLOSE - LLV(LOW,9)) / (HHV(HIGH,9) - LLV(LOW,9))) * 100); KK:=SMA(RSVK,3,1); DK:=SMA(KK,3,1); JK:=((3 * KK) - (2 * DK)); VARA1:=(((CLOSE - MA(CLOSE,6)) / MA(CLOSE,6)) * 100); VARA2:=(((CLOSE - MA(CLOSE,12)) / MA(CLOSE,12)) * 100); VARA3:=(((CLOSE - MA(CLOSE,24)) / MA(CLOSE,24)) * 100); VARA4:=(((VARA1 + (2 * VARA2)) + (3 * VARA3)) / 6); VARA5:MA(VARA4,3); STICKLINE((CROSS(JK,0) AND (VARA5 <= (0 - 7))),0,15,2,0),COLOR7AB500; DRAWTEXT((CROSS(JK,0) AND (VARA5 <= (0 - 7))),15,'←抄底'),COLOR0000FF; 抄底:CROSS(JK,0) AND (VARA5 <= (0 - 7)); LC:=REF(CLOSE,1); RSI:=SMA(MAX(CLOSE-LC,0),6,1)/SMA(ABS(CLOSE-LC),6,1)*100; 顶部:=CROSS(80,RSI)*35; 逃顶:=顶部; 顶K:IF(逃顶>REF(逃顶,1),35,0),COLOR7AB500; DRAWICON(顶K=35,130,39); DRAWTEXT(顶K=35,130,'←逃顶'),COLORFF0000; 主升K:=COUNT(HDY<10,2) AND CROSS(CCI(84),-100) AND HHV(H,14)/LLV(L,6)>1.21 AND COUNT(C/REF(C,1)<0.95,6),COLORRED; STICKLINE(主升K,0,35,3,0),COLORRED; DRAWTEXT(主升K,28,'★主升浪')COLORRED;